Confit lemon, orange blossom and white lily exude on the nose, nestling amongst ripe apricot, white peach and baked red apple. The palate intensifies, evolving into tarte Tatin, almond croissant and a dusting of crumble, yet maintaining a precise structure, creamy texture and mouth-watering acidity.

The finish develops a mineral, chalky quality, nodding to our Hampshire terroir, and the svelte mousse remains persistent and elegant. Incredibly complex and immensely enjoyable.

About Hambledon Vineyard

Established in 1952 by Major-General Sir Guy Salisbury-Jones, Hambledon Vineyard boasts a rich heritage as England’s oldest commercial vineyard. Nestled in the picturesque Hampshire countryside, known as the ‘Cradle of Cricket,’ it stands as a pioneer of English winemaking innovation.

The vineyard's success is deeply rooted in its geology. The vines flourish on chalky soils formed over 65 million years ago in the Paris Basin seabed, a terroir strikingly similar to the Champagne region. This unique foundation provides the perfect conditions for producing exceptional sparkling wines.
